Outline of Final Research Achievements

Japanese regional capitals such as Sapporo, Sendai, Hiroshima, and Fukuoka have rapidly grown since the 1950s. The main driving force behind the remarkable development of regional capitals was the agglomeration of branch offices headquartered in Tokyo or Osaka. However, during the latter half of the 1990s, branch agglomeration in regional capitals stopped increasing and began to decrease. Consequently, regional capitals needed to explore ways other than development to achieve hierarchical inter-city linking with Tokyo as the apex. One expected way is to expand the city network of horizontal intercity linkages focusing on individual cities. The network is called the “individual city-centered network.” Actors that develop these networks are various entities such as government agencies, companies, civil-society groups, citizens, and travelers operating in the city.

Academic Significance and Societal Importance of the Research Achievements

地方中枢都市の成長は東京を頂点とした階層構造の下での現象であったとはいえ、地方振興にとって欠かせないものであった。しかし、地方中枢都市の成長を支えてきた支店集積は1990年代以降減少に転じた。この事実認識は地方中枢都市の持続的発展の方向および地方振興の在り方を議論する上で欠かせない点であり、本研究でも再度強調した、加えて、従来の都市および地域の振興策の議論において乏しかった空間関係の観点を導入することで、地方中枢都市の持続可能な活性化の方策として自都市中心のネットワーク形成の必要性を説くことができた。
